IVR Phone Tree: IVR for beginners. Powered by Twilio - Node.js/Express

Node.js CI

Create a seamless customer service experience by building an IVR Phone Tree for your company. IVR systems allow your customers to access the people and information they need.

Local Development

This project is build using Express web framework and depends on MongoDB.

  1. First clone this repository and cd into it.

    git clone [email protected]:TwilioDevEd/ivr-phone-tree-node.git \
    cd ivr-phone-tree-node
  2. Install project's dependencies.

    npm install
  3. Make sure the tests succeed.

    npm test
  4. Start the development server.

    npm start

    Alternatively you might also consider using nodemon for this. It works just like the node command, but automatically restarts your application when you change any source code files.

    npm install -g nodemon \
    nodemon .
  5. Check it out at http://localhost:3000.

  6. Expose the application to the wider Internet using ngrok.

    ngrok http 3000
  7. Provision a number under the Twilio's Manage Numbers page on your account. Set the voice URL for the number to http://[your-ngrok-subdomain].ngrok.io/ivr/welcome

several issues found when twilio / node newbie installs

Hi !

Thanks for your code I did get it to work but here are some issues I found along the way:

1 - the twilio phone url must be a post not a get
2 - views/layout.jade can not find:

  • link(rel='stylesheet', type='text/css', href='/stylesheets/style.css')
  • script(src='/javascripts/modernizr-2.6.2.js')

I copied the modernizr file into the views folder and changed my layout.jade to this:

doctype html
html
head
meta(charset='utf-8')
meta(name='viewport', content='width=device-width, initial-scale=1.0')
title IVR Phone Tree
script(src='modernizr-2.6.2.js')
body
.container.body-content
block content
footer
| Made with
i.fa.fa-heart
| by your pals
|
a(href='http://www.twilio.com') @twilio

then it worked
